Pilates Club Prices: A Comprehensive Guide

Pilates is a popular form of exercise that has gained widespread recognition in recent years due to its numerous health benefits. However, many people are hesitant to join a Pilates club or studio because they are unsure about the costs involved. In this article, we will explore the different types of Pilates club prices and what you can expect from each.

Introduction

Pilates clubs and studios offer various pricing options to suit different budgets and preferences. While some may be more expensive than others, the quality of instruction, equipment, and facilities is often comparable across different centers. When choosing a Pilates club, it’s essential to consider factors beyond just cost, such as the level of expertise among instructors, class variety, and overall atmosphere.

Key Points

1. Membership Options: Most Pilates clubs offer flexible membership plans that cater to various needs and budgets. These may include monthly or annual subscriptions, trial periods, or pay-as-you-go options. It’s crucial to evaluate the different membership options available and choose one that aligns with your exercise goals and financial situation. 2. Class Pricing: The cost of Pilates classes varies depending on the club, instructor, and type of class offered. Some studios may charge per session, while others offer package deals or discounts for bulk bookings. Be sure to check the pricing structure before committing to a specific club or studio. 3. Private Lessons: If you’re looking for personalized attention or require specialized instruction, private lessons can be an excellent option. These sessions are typically more expensive than group classes but provide tailored guidance and support. When considering private lessons, evaluate the instructor’s qualifications, experience, and your own goals to determine if this is the best fit for you. 4. Workshops and Events: Many Pilates clubs host workshops, masterclasses, or special events that can enhance your practice and knowledge of Pilates. These events may be included in membership packages or available as separate charges. Make sure to check what’s included in these events and whether they align with your interests and goals. 5. Equipment and Facilities: The quality of equipment and facilities is an essential aspect of any Pilates club or studio. Ensure that the club you choose has well-maintained equipment, spacious classes, and a clean environment. This will not only improve your practice but also contribute to your overall fitness journey. 6. Discounts and Promotions: Some Pilates clubs offer discounts for students, seniors, or military personnel. Keep an eye out for promotions, loyalty programs, or special offers that can help you save money on membership fees or classes. 7. Instructor Expertise: The qualifications, experience, and teaching style of instructors can significantly impact your practice. Research the instructors at potential clubs and read reviews from past clients to ensure that their values and methods align with yours. 8. Class Variety and Schedule: A diverse range of classes and a suitable schedule are vital for keeping your practice engaging and effective. Look for clubs that offer various styles, levels, and formats to cater to different interests and fitness goals. 9. Insurance and Liability: Some Pilates clubs may require clients to have health insurance or sign liability waivers before participating in group classes. Make sure you understand the club’s policies on these matters before joining. 10. Cancellation Policies: Many clubs have strict cancellation policies, which can impact your membership fees. Understand the terms of any agreement you enter into with a Pilates club and be aware of the potential consequences if you need to cancel or reschedule classes.
